Collection Highlights
The stunning permanent gallery, cΜΙsnaΚΙm: the city before the city, shares the story of a 5,000-year-old Musqueam village site. You can't miss the 'Neon Vancouver | Ugly Vancouver' exhibit either, with its glowing vintage signs that tell a more recent story of the city's changing face.

Architecture & Building
The building is a wonderful example of mid-century modern architecture, all sharp angles and concrete, looking a bit like a futuristic spaceship that landed gracefully in the park.
